excel的空白页怎么删除不了

excel的空白页怎么删除不了

要删除Excel中的空白页,您可以尝试以下几种方法:检查是否有隐藏内容、清除格式和内容、调整工作表的打印区域。这些方法可以帮助您有效地清除无法删除的空白页。例如,检查是否有隐藏内容可以让您发现并删除可能影响页面删除的隐藏数据或格式。

一、检查是否有隐藏内容

在某些情况下,Excel中的空白页可能并不是真的空白。它们可能包含隐藏的内容或格式,这些内容会导致页面无法删除。

1. 检查隐藏行和列

首先,您可以通过检查工作表中的隐藏行和列来查找隐藏内容:

  1. 选择整个工作表。
  2. 右键点击行号或列号。
  3. 选择“取消隐藏”。

通过取消隐藏行和列,您可以查看是否有隐藏的内容或格式在阻止您删除空白页。

2. 检查内容和格式

有时候,单元格中的格式或内容可能是不可见的,但它们仍然存在并占用空间。您可以通过以下步骤清除这些内容:

  1. 选择整个工作表。
  2. 点击“开始”选项卡。
  3. 在“编辑”组中,点击“清除”。
  4. 选择“清除内容”和“清除格式”。

这将删除所有不可见的内容和格式,可能会解决空白页无法删除的问题。

二、清除格式和内容

清除格式和内容是另一种有效的方法,可以确保您的工作表没有残留的格式或内容,导致无法删除空白页。

1. 使用“清除内容”功能

使用“清除内容”功能可以帮助您清除所有选定单元格中的内容,而不影响其格式。以下是步骤:

  1. 选择您认为是空白的行或列。
  2. 点击“开始”选项卡。
  3. 在“编辑”组中,点击“清除”。
  4. 选择“清除内容”。

这样可以确保没有任何隐藏的内容阻止您删除空白页。

2. 使用“清除格式”功能

有时候,单元格格式可能是导致空白页无法删除的原因。您可以使用“清除格式”功能来清除所有选定单元格的格式:

  1. 选择您认为是空白的行或列。
  2. 点击“开始”选项卡。
  3. 在“编辑”组中,点击“清除”。
  4. 选择“清除格式”。

这将删除所有单元格格式,确保没有任何残留的格式影响页面删除。

三、调整工作表的打印区域

有时候,Excel的打印区域设置可能会导致空白页无法删除。您可以通过调整打印区域来解决这个问题。

1. 检查打印区域

首先,您需要检查当前的打印区域设置:

  1. 点击“页面布局”选项卡。
  2. 在“页面设置”组中,点击“打印区域”。
  3. 选择“查看打印区域”。

这将显示当前的打印区域,您可以检查是否包含不必要的空白页。

2. 重新设置打印区域

如果打印区域设置不正确,您可以通过以下步骤重新设置打印区域:

  1. 选择您希望打印的内容区域。
  2. 点击“页面布局”选项卡。
  3. 在“页面设置”组中,点击“打印区域”。
  4. 选择“设置打印区域”。

这将重新设置打印区域,排除空白页。

四、删除特定的空白行或列

有时候,您可能需要删除特定的空白行或列来解决空白页问题。这通常是手动操作,但可以非常有效。

1. 手动删除空白行

手动删除空白行可以确保您只删除确实没有内容的行:

  1. 选择空白行。
  2. 右键点击行号。
  3. 选择“删除”。

2. 手动删除空白列

手动删除空白列的步骤与删除行类似:

  1. 选择空白列。
  2. 右键点击列号。
  3. 选择“删除”。

五、使用宏自动删除空白行或列

如果您的工作表中有大量的空白行或列,手动删除可能会非常耗时。您可以使用Excel宏来自动删除这些空白行或列。

1. 创建宏

您可以通过以下步骤创建宏:

  1. 按下“Alt + F11”打开VBA编辑器。
  2. 在“插入”菜单中,选择“模块”。
  3. 输入以下代码:
    Sub DeleteBlankRows()

    Dim i As Long

    For i = ActiveSheet.UsedRange.Rows.Count To 1 Step -1

    If Application.WorksheetFunction.CountA(ActiveSheet.Rows(i)) = 0 Then

    ActiveSheet.Rows(i).Delete

    End If

    Next i

    End Sub

    Sub DeleteBlankColumns()

    Dim j As Long

    For j = ActiveSheet.UsedRange.Columns.Count To 1 Step -1

    If Application.WorksheetFunction.CountA(ActiveSheet.Columns(j)) = 0 Then

    ActiveSheet.Columns(j).Delete

    End If

    Next j

    End Sub

2. 运行宏

创建宏后,您可以通过以下步骤运行它:

  1. 关闭VBA编辑器。
  2. 按下“Alt + F8”打开宏对话框。
  3. 选择“DeleteBlankRows”或“DeleteBlankColumns”。
  4. 点击“运行”。

这将自动删除所有空白行或列,可能会解决空白页无法删除的问题。

六、检查文件损坏

如果以上方法都无法解决问题,您的文件可能已经损坏。您可以尝试以下步骤来修复文件:

1. 使用Excel内置的修复工具

Excel内置了一些修复工具,可以帮助您修复损坏的文件:

  1. 打开Excel。
  2. 点击“文件”菜单。
  3. 选择“打开”。
  4. 找到并选择损坏的文件。
  5. 点击“打开”按钮旁边的箭头,选择“打开并修复”。

2. 使用第三方修复工具

如果内置修复工具无法解决问题,您可以考虑使用第三方修复工具。这些工具通常具有更强大的修复功能,可以修复各种Excel文件损坏问题。

七、使用新的工作表

如果文件损坏严重,您可能需要创建一个新的工作表并将数据复制到新工作表中。以下是步骤:

  1. 创建一个新的工作表。
  2. 选择原始工作表中的所有数据。
  3. 复制数据。
  4. 粘贴数据到新工作表。

八、使用数据筛选功能

数据筛选功能可以帮助您快速找到并删除空白行或列:

  1. 选择数据范围。
  2. 点击“数据”选项卡。
  3. 在“排序和筛选”组中,点击“筛选”。
  4. 点击每列标题旁边的箭头,取消选择“空白”。

这将隐藏所有空白行或列,您可以选择并删除它们。

九、检查工作表保护

有时候,工作表保护可能会阻止您删除空白页。您可以通过以下步骤取消工作表保护:

  1. 点击“审阅”选项卡。
  2. 在“更改”组中,点击“取消保护工作表”。
  3. 输入密码(如果有)。

十、使用高级选项

Excel提供了一些高级选项,可以帮助您更好地管理工作表:

1. 使用“定位条件”功能

“定位条件”功能可以帮助您快速找到并删除空白单元格:

  1. 按下“Ctrl + G”打开“定位”对话框。
  2. 点击“定位条件”。
  3. 选择“空值”。

2. 使用“删除”功能

使用“删除”功能可以帮助您快速删除选定的空白单元格:

  1. 选择空白单元格。
  2. 点击“开始”选项卡。
  3. 在“单元格”组中,点击“删除”。

总结

删除Excel中的空白页可能需要一些耐心和技巧。通过检查是否有隐藏内容、清除格式和内容、调整工作表的打印区域、手动删除空白行或列、使用宏、检查文件损坏、使用新的工作表、使用数据筛选功能、检查工作表保护和使用高级选项,您可以有效地解决这个问题。希望这些方法对您有所帮助。

相关问答FAQs:

1. 如何删除Excel中的空白页?
在Excel中删除空白页非常简单。您只需按照以下步骤操作即可:

  • 首先,选中要删除的空白页。您可以通过点击标签页来选择特定的页,或者按住Ctrl键并点击多个标签页来选择多个页。
  • 接下来,右键单击选中的标签页,并选择“删除”。这将删除选中的空白页。
  • 最后,点击“确认”以确认删除操作。空白页将被永久删除。

2. 为什么我无法删除Excel中的空白页?
如果您发现无法删除Excel中的空白页,可能有以下原因:

  • 首先,空白页可能包含锁定的单元格或对象,这会阻止删除操作。您可以尝试解锁这些单元格或对象,然后再进行删除。
  • 其次,空白页可能是由于数据连接或公式引用而产生的。在删除之前,您需要先断开这些连接或删除相关的公式引用。
  • 最后,空白页可能被保护,以防止意外删除。您可以尝试取消保护,然后再进行删除。

3. 如何确定Excel中的空白页是真的空白页?
有时候,我们可能会误认为某个标签页是空白页,但实际上它可能包含了一些微小或隐藏的数据。为了确定一个标签页是否真的是空白页,您可以尝试以下方法:

  • 首先,检查标签页上是否存在任何单元格或对象。即使数据很少或微小,也可能导致Excel将其视为非空白页。
  • 其次,您可以尝试清除标签页上的所有内容和格式。通过选择整个标签页,然后按下Ctrl + A键,接着按下Delete键,可以一次性清除所有内容和格式。
  • 最后,您还可以使用筛选功能来查找隐藏的数据。通过点击数据选项卡上的“筛选”,然后选择“清除筛选”,可以清除任何筛选并显示所有数据。这样可以确保标签页上没有隐藏的数据存在。

希望以上解答对您有所帮助!如果您还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4907121

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部